The cheapest way to get from Heysham to Chester is to drive which costs £19 - £29 and takes 1h 35m.
The fastest way to get from Heysham to Chester is to drive which takes 1h 35m and costs £19 - £29.
No, there is no direct bus from Heysham to Chester. However, there are services departing from Seymour Avenue and arriving at Chester Bus Interchange via Bus Station, Bus Station, Union Street and Whitechapel.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 7h 30m.
The distance between Heysham and Chester is 74 miles. The road distance is 80.6 miles.
The best way to get from Heysham to Chester without a car is to bus and train which takes 2h 33m and costs £25 - £95.
It takes approximately 2h 33m to get from Heysham to Chester, including transfers.
